摘要:
controller, bindings https://blog.csdn.net/qq_36407748/article/details/115213064 service https://blog.csdn.net/weixin_43575775/article/details/1371069
阅读全文
posted @ 2024-07-13 10:30
CrossPython
阅读(60)
推荐(0)
摘要:
xml: <button class="btn btn-outline-primary m-1" t-on-click="()=>this.runtask('MM离线文件')">MM离线文件</button> js /** @odoo-module **/ import { registry } f
阅读全文
posted @ 2024-07-09 19:29
CrossPython
阅读(45)
推荐(0)
摘要:
import openpyxl from openpyxl.styles import Alignment from openpyxl.utils import get_column_letter from openpyxl.styles import PatternFill, Border, Si
阅读全文
posted @ 2024-07-08 10:32
CrossPython
阅读(28)
推荐(0)
摘要:
假设私钥和CSR都生成后放到用户目录. 假设用户目录是 /home/user/ (根据具体用户名更改成自己的) 先生成私钥:openssl genrsa -out /home/user/privatekey.pem 2048 再生成csropenssl req -new -key /home/use
阅读全文
posted @ 2024-07-05 13:41
CrossPython
阅读(47)
推荐(0)
摘要:
在一个组件之上快速加另外一个包裹: 定位到需要包裹的组件, 按 alt + enter 根据需要选择. 对一个组件快速折叠: ctrl "-" (减号) 对一个组件快速打开 ctrl "+" (加号) 快速格式化代码 ctrl + alt + L
阅读全文
posted @ 2024-06-28 22:07
CrossPython
阅读(22)
推荐(0)
摘要:
https://www.cnblogs.com/lqtbk/p/10233315.html
阅读全文
posted @ 2024-05-20 18:08
CrossPython
阅读(35)
推荐(0)
摘要:
<td>{{ row.submit_time | date:'Y-m-d H:i:s' }}</td>
阅读全文
posted @ 2024-03-12 10:19
CrossPython
阅读(43)
推荐(0)
摘要:
import itchat from itchat.content import TEXT, MAP, CARD, NOTE, SHARING, PICTURE, RECORDING, ATTACHMENT, VIDEO, FRIENDS, SYSTEM # 下载文件到本地 def download
阅读全文
posted @ 2024-02-19 14:33
CrossPython
阅读(148)
推荐(0)
摘要:
只需添加两个 SingleChildScrollView: child: SingleChildScrollView( scrollDirection: Axis.vertical, child: SingleChildScrollView( scrollDirection: Axis.horizo
阅读全文
posted @ 2023-12-12 16:53
CrossPython
阅读(149)
推荐(0)
摘要:
E:\www\odoo17\odoo\tools\_monkeypatches.py 注释 # FileStorage.save = lambda self, dst, buffer_size=1<<20: copyfileobj(self.stream, dst, buffer_size) 之后可
阅读全文
posted @ 2023-12-05 17:03
CrossPython
阅读(75)
推荐(0)
摘要:
禁用任务计划SCHTASKS /change /DISABLE /TN “你的任务计划中的名称”例: SCHTASKS /change /DISABLE /TN GoogleUpdate 启用任务计划SCHTASKS /change /ENABLE /TN “你的任务计划中的名称”例:SCHTASK
阅读全文
posted @ 2023-12-04 14:16
CrossPython
阅读(298)
推荐(0)
摘要:
git clone --single-branch --branch main https://github.com/hiroi-sora/Umi-OCR.git
阅读全文
posted @ 2023-11-30 18:48
CrossPython
阅读(144)
推荐(0)
摘要:
//////////////////////////////////////////////// 运行 ////////////////////////////////////////////////////////////////// #!/bin/bash /opt/odoo16env/bin/
阅读全文
posted @ 2023-11-29 10:17
CrossPython
阅读(153)
推荐(0)
摘要:
use std::process::Command; fn callcmd(cmdstr: &str) { Command::new("cmd") .arg("/S") .arg("/c") .arg(cmdstr) .output() .expect("-1"); } fn main() { le
阅读全文
posted @ 2023-11-28 14:05
CrossPython
阅读(298)
推荐(1)
摘要:
示例一:logging模块简单使用 basicConfig #!/usr/bin/python2.7 # -*- coding:utf-8 -*- """ @author: tz_zs """ import logging import time import traceback import sy
阅读全文
posted @ 2023-11-27 11:47
CrossPython
阅读(139)
推荐(0)
摘要:
GitHub520文件:https://raw.hellogithub.com/hostsJSON:https://raw.hellogithub.com/hosts.json Edge: watt toolkitdev-sidecarfastgithub
阅读全文
posted @ 2023-11-20 21:01
CrossPython
阅读(51)
推荐(0)
摘要:
Nginx实例 完整Nginx.conf示例 参考官方文档即可 #odoo server upstream odoo { server 127.0.0.1:8069; } upstream odoochat { server 127.0.0.1:8072; } map $http_upgrade $
阅读全文
posted @ 2023-11-18 14:03
CrossPython
阅读(206)
推荐(0)
摘要:
Ubuntu 上更换软件源的详细步骤:打开终端,输入以下命令备份原有的软件源列表: s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ak打开软件源列表文件: sudo nano /etc/apt/sources.list将原有的软件源地址替换
阅读全文
posted @ 2023-11-16 10:57
CrossPython
阅读(399)
推荐(0)
摘要:
https://blog.csdn.net/ken2232/article/details/132529761 如何修复 System has not been booted with systemd 报错信息? 最简单的方式就是不使用 systemctl 命令,而是使用 sysvinit 命令。
阅读全文
posted @ 2023-11-15 22:18
CrossPython
阅读(177)
推荐(0)
摘要:
git clone https://www.github.com/odoo/odoo --depth 1 --branch 17.0
阅读全文
posted @ 2023-11-09 10:03
CrossPython
阅读(153)
推荐(0)
摘要:
一、windows系统下Nginx安装启动流程:二、设置Nginx开机自动启动1、自启动工具下载2、自启动工具安装3、把nginx加入到windows服务中最后一句话一、windows系统下Nginx安装启动流程:这是我们在正常环境中,Windows下Nginx的安装及启动方式 1、到nginx官网
阅读全文
posted @ 2023-11-06 16:46
CrossPython
阅读(1355)
推荐(0)
摘要:
更换安装依赖的镜像,使用淘宝镜像安装,代码如下: yarn config set registry https://registry.npm.taobao.org 移除原代理: yarn config delete proxy npm config rm proxy npm config rm ht
阅读全文
posted @ 2023-11-05 22:13
CrossPython
阅读(543)
推荐(0)
摘要:
yarn config set registry https://registry.npm.taobao.org -g yarn config set sass_binary_site http://cdn.npm.taobao.org/dist/node-sass -g # 查看当前npm的软件源
阅读全文
posted @ 2023-11-05 21:27
CrossPython
阅读(565)
推荐(0)
摘要:
Flutter 2.8.1 • channel stable • https://github.com/flutter/flutter.gitFramework • revision 77d935af4d (1 year, 11 months ago) • 2021-12-16 08:37:33 -
阅读全文
posted @ 2023-11-05 18:26
CrossPython
阅读(9)
推荐(0)
摘要:
"start": " SET NODE_OPTIONS openssl-legacy-provider && cross-env UMI_ENV=dev umi dev", "start:dev": "SET NODE_OPTIONS openssl-legacy-provider && cross
阅读全文
posted @ 2023-11-05 17:15
CrossPython
阅读(50)
推荐(0)
摘要:
rocket.chat IRC ZULIP LET'S CHAT https://fanlv.fun/2023/07/16/chat-room-with-rust/#2-6-QUIC
阅读全文
posted @ 2023-11-04 10:35
CrossPython
阅读(305)
推荐(0)
摘要:
开发中遇到一个需求是考勤记录普通用户只能看自己的考勤记录,管理员可有看所有人的考勤记录,这个需求使用两个规则记录就可以搞定了,但是在加班申请中需要展示对应日期的考勤记录,审批人也是普通用户无法看到他人的考勤记录,这个是时候就需要屏蔽规则记录了 追踪了下ir.rule的生效方法: 模型基类中有一个方法
阅读全文
posted @ 2023-11-03 21:36
CrossPython
阅读(113)
推荐(0)
摘要:
p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simplepip config set install.trusted-host pypi.tuna.tsinghua.edu.cn
阅读全文
posted @ 2023-11-03 16:04
CrossPython
阅读(26)
推荐(0)
摘要:
本章主要讨论 axum 的响应。axum 已经实现了多种响应,比如纯文本、HTML、JSON 及 自定义响应头(response header)。除了这些 axum 内置的响应之外,我们还将讨论如何将自己定义的结构体,作为响应返回给客户端。 axum 的响应 axum 有句话说的是: Anythin
阅读全文
posted @ 2023-11-02 09:51
CrossPython
阅读(795)
推荐(0)
摘要:
在日常开发中,我们需要与用户进行交互,从各种渠道获取用户输入,包括但不限于:表单、URL 参数、URL Path 以及 JSON 等。axum 为我们提供了这些获取用户输入的支持。 获取 Path 参数 Path 参数,又称为“路径参数”,它既可以实现参数的传递,又对 SEO 友好。 什么是 Pat
阅读全文
posted @ 2023-11-02 09:50
CrossPython
阅读(715)
推荐(0)
摘要:
状态共享是指,在整个应用或不同路由之间,共享一份数据。axum 提供了方便的状态共享机制,但可能也会踩坑。本章将带你学习如何在 axum web 应用中共享状态。 如何进行状态共享 axum 使用 Layer 来实现状态共享。 定义路由时,使用 layer() 加入要共享的数据,在需要获取该共享数据
阅读全文
posted @ 2023-11-02 09:50
CrossPython
阅读(524)
推荐(0)
摘要:
axum 提供了常用的 HTTP 请求方式对应的路由,比如 get, post, put, delete 等。除此之外,axum 还提供了“嵌套路由”。路由,通常和 handler(处理函数) 结合在一起。 handler 是什么 通常理解,handler 是指接收用户的请求,并将处理结果作为响应返
阅读全文
posted @ 2023-11-02 09:49
CrossPython
阅读(161)
推荐(0)
摘要:
中间件是一类提供系统软件和应用软件之间连接、便于软件各部件之间的沟通的软件,应用软件可以借助中间件在不同的技术架构之间共享信息与资源。 ——摘自维基百科; 在《axum 的状态共享》中,我们已经用到了中间件:用于添加共享数据的 AddExtension 中间件——它应用于AddExtensionLa
阅读全文
posted @ 2023-11-02 09:48
CrossPython
阅读(111)
推荐(0)
摘要:
和其它 Web 框架一样,axum 也会对所有请求进行处理。对于 CSS、JS 及图片等静态文件,并不需要 axum 的 handler 进行处理,而是只需要简单的把它们的内容进行返回即可。axum 提供了处理静态文件的中间件。 首先,我们创建一个名为 static 的目录,并在其中创建一个 axu
阅读全文
posted @ 2023-11-02 09:48
CrossPython
阅读(681)
推荐(0)
摘要:
Cookie 是通过 HTTP Header 进行传递的。由某个响应头进行设置,然后其它请求头就可以获取到了。本章将通过模拟用户中心来用 axum 操作 HTTP Header 演示 Cookie 的读写操作。 本章示例将实现以下路由: 路由说明 GET / 用户中心首页。如果用户未登录,显示提示信
阅读全文
posted @ 2023-11-02 09:47
CrossPython
阅读(324)
推荐(0)
摘要:
通过 redis-rs 这个 crate,可以很方便的操作 redis。它提供了同步和异步两种连接,由于我们要集成到 axum 中,所以这里使用异步连接。本章将展示如何获取 redis 异步连接、如何将字符串保存到 redis、如何获取到保存在 redis 里的字符串以及如何通过 redis 保存和
阅读全文
posted @ 2023-11-02 09:46
CrossPython
阅读(242)
推荐(0)
摘要:
PostgreSQL 是一款天然支持异步操作的高性能开源关系型数据库。本章将讨论如何在 axum 中使用 PostgreSQL。包括:数据的增加、修改、删除、查找以及开始事务保证业务的原子性。 如果你对 PostgreSQL 不是很了解,可以通过PostgreSQL 轻松学网站进行学习。 Eleph
阅读全文
posted @ 2023-11-02 09:46
CrossPython
阅读(348)
推荐(0)
摘要:
由于 HTTP 是无状态的,所以我们可以通过cookie来维护状态。但 cookie 是直接保存到客户端,所以对于敏感数据,不能直接保存到 cookie。我们可以把敏感数据保存到服务端,然后把对应的 ID 保存到 cookie,这就是 Session。本章我们将使用 Cookie 和 Redis 实
阅读全文
posted @ 2023-11-02 09:44
CrossPython
阅读(301)
推荐(0)
摘要:
Json web token(JWT)是为了网络应用环境间传递声明而执行的一种基于 JSON 的开发标准(RFC 7519),该 token 被设计为紧凑且安全的,特别适用于分布式站点的单点登陆(SSO)场景。JWT 的声明一般被用来在身份提供者和服务提供者间传递被认证的用户身份信息,以便于从资源服
阅读全文
posted @ 2023-11-02 09:43
CrossPython
阅读(500)
推荐(0)
摘要:
利用模板引擎,我们不需要再把 HTML 代码写在 Rust 代码中了,而是将其独立保存为*.html文件。既方便维护,也有利用开发。 创建模板文件 首先,我们在项目根目录创建一个templates目录,并在这个目录创建一个index.html文件,内容如下: <!DOCTYPE html> <htm
阅读全文
posted @ 2023-11-02 09:43
CrossPython
阅读(343)
推荐(0)